Beinn nan Imirean is a rounded, rather featureless Corbett on the north side of Glen Dochart. It provides a short ascent on its own, or a prelude to a very strenuous day if combined with Meall Glas and Sgiath Chuil.

Terrain

Boggy hill path for much of the ascent; final section is pathless.

Public Transport

None to start.

Start

Junction of Auchessan track with A85. Open start point in Google Maps for directions.
